The match between Atletico Grau and Deportivo Garcilaso ended in a 2-2 draw, a result reflecting the competitive nature of both teams. Atletico Grau demonstrated offensive prowess, creating numerous scoring opportunities, evidenced by their impressive count of 11 corner kicks compared to Deportivo Garcilaso's 2. This significant disparity in corners highlights Atletico Grau's dominance in attacking play, as they frequently threatened the opposition's defense.

On the defensive front, Deportivo Garcilaso's ability to absorb pressure was vital. Despite facing numerous corner kicks and offensive setups from Atletico Grau, they managed to maintain composure and limit the home team to just two goals. However, Deportivo Garcilaso's aggressive play resulted in them receiving two yellow cards, signaling a potential area of discipline that they might need to address for tighter matches in the future.

Teamwork and discipline also played a pivotal role for both sides. Atletico Grau's quick response to Deportivo Garcilaso’s goals showcased their resilience and ability to swiftly regroup and counterattack. On the other hand, the close timing of yellow cards received by Atletico Grau in the second half highlighted possible lapses in discipline during high-pressure moments, which could have led to game-altering consequences had they not managed to equalize swiftly. Overall, the match was a balanced contest with each team leveraging their strengths and making tactical adjustments in real-time.
